So we all heard AoC didn't had so many buyer and that many do not renew ...

 

I'd like to somehow estimate the number of subscriber, and so I'd like to know the number of server for each region:

- US: 25

- United Kingdom / European: 14

- French: 4

- German: 6

- Spanish: 1

 

 

Anyone care to check ingame?

 

 

edit: added spanish and reworded

edit: updated based on Nadia links

 

So from my experience there are at most 5k active subscriber per server, and I don't hink Funcom has been able to push that limit up. So that's 5000 * 50 = 250k subscribers big max

Since 5k is optimistic, I think a really number would be 3.5k. In such case that would be 3500 * 50 = 175k subscribers

seriously... that's kind of an unrealistic way to try to estimate the game's population. Like a previous poster said, it's like guessing from a crystal ball if you use that method. You cannot give a correct estimate on exactly how many players are on each server other than by guessing by a server's population... and even then, we do not know how much each server can hold, and depending on how the game is functioned, each server can hold a slightly different number of players (very slight, like 1% capacity difference, but with a good amount of servers that are in AoC it adds up).

I'd guess that they'd probably have at least 200k still at this point. But that's my own personal estimate.

Hmm, I heard that they increaed the numbers on each server (on the AoC forum). 

To be honest, the numbers of instances and the players in the cities seems about the same now as it have since release. We can all guess the numbers of people playing but thats kind of worthless. Quite a few of the players who bought the game quited, most of them early or when their free month was up.

Someone said that they sold 800K boxes and if that is true i would guess that it is somewhere between 200K to 400K players still playing but as I said, guessing is worthless. It is still sold out in many shops here.

What I do have noticed however is that many of the players are roleplayers and a bit older than the players of Wow.

And I dont think it's useful to count the numbers 'til after a few months anyways, some players bought 3 months and quited, some will start after they tried the buddy keys which isn't out yet, some will do like one of my friends and uppgrade their computers during the summer and start after that. The first months are usually bumpy for a game, then it tends to stabilise more and slowly go up or down.

My point is that a server cannot hold more than a set number of active players at once. Usually (based on other mmorpg) that amount is around 3500.

It doesn't mean 3500 playing at the same time, usually, they expect a peak around 2k players at once during peak time

 

Still I agree that I'm probably wrong, it is only an estimation, but I personally doubt they have 10k players per servers.

 

I can't find the link anymore but I read recently that they were targeting for 3k per server (at least it's the number that has printed in my brain :) )

 

 

Something is wrong when we compare to the numbr of copies sold ... there are something I don't understand. The only solution I see is that they pushed that limit much further at launch which could explain many of the issues they met (lag, disconnection, ...)
